Task to be carried out.

Page 19 (2m 24s)

We were provided with two truss models: one is determinate, and the other one is indeterminate. We are tasked with analyzing both trusses and designing the more economical option among the two..

Page 20 (2m 39s)

Applied Methodology.

Page 21 (2m 47s)

Step 1: We have various load combinations, out of which one is selected that results in the maximum load. Calculations shown below.

Page 32 (11m 9s)

Determinate Truss VS Total weight of determinate truss = 484kg or 1069.2lbs Weight Price per kg = 244rs Total price according to member weight = 236,672rs (excluding lateral connection) Price The determinate truss has a top chord in compression while bottom chord in tension which shows that determinate truss can expand in case of loading. Behavior Indeterminate Truss Total weight of indeterminate truss = 516kg or 1138.8lbs Weight Price per kg = 244rs Total price according to member weight = 252,084rs (excluding lateral connection) Price The indeterminate truss has all members in compression. It cannot move horizontally or vertically. All the members are kind of confined between both hinges and hinges provide equal and opposite reactions. Behavior Determinate vs Indeterminate Truss.
